12. Hacker’s Keyboard

© Android Booth
If you want the key layout you’re used to from your computer with your Android, then Hacker’s keyboard is one of the best keyboards for Android. This app has separate number keys, arrow keys, and punctuation in the usual places. It’s completely based on the AOSP Gingerbread soft keyboard so that it supports multitouch for the modifier keys.
Hacker’s keyboard is especially useful when you use ConnectBot for SSH access. It also provides working keys (Tab/Ctrl/Esc), and the arrow keys are essential for devices that don’t have a trackball or D-Pad. This keyboard also supports the use of dictionaries (but not keyboard layouts) provided by AnySoftKeyboard language packs.

14. Smart Keyboard Trial

© Android Booth
This is the trial version of Smart Keyboard Pro, which is Lightweight, doesn’t use a lot of memory, and easy to customize. It’s one of the most lightweight and the best keyboards for Android with multitouch, and multi-language support. It offers skins for keyboard, voice input, Smart dictionary, T9 and compact, custom Auto-Text, calibration, hard keyboard support, many appearance and prediction options.
The Pro version of Smart keyboard is a standalone app, so you don’t need to keep this Trial if you installed the Pro version. It also allows you to transfer easily your settings to the Pro version by using ”Backup to SD card” option in Trial settings, and “Restore from Trial” in Pro settings.
